Crushed Stone
Crushed stone is favored where high mechanical strength, angularity, and tighter gradation are critical for structural layers and high-performance concrete. It is widely used in base courses, rail ballast, and mixes requiring superior load-bearing capacity. Producers emphasize investments in crushing and screening technology, dust suppression, and automation to elevate product consistency while navigating permitting and environmental constraints.
Sand
Sand remains essential for concrete and mortar, influencing workability, water demand, and finish quality. Markets are shaped by the interplay between natural river sand access and the rise of manufactured sand (M-sand) where sustainability rules tighten. Suppliers differentiate through wash plants, fines recovery, and compliance with specifications, helping contractors meet evolving building codes and architectural requirements.
Gravel
Gravel offers strong drainage characteristics and is widely used in road layers, landscaping, and low-slump applications where rounded particles are advantageous. Regional deposits and pit licensing shape local price competitiveness and availability. Operators focus on fleet optimization and multi-site sourcing to reduce transport costs, while customers prioritize supply reliability during seasonal peaks in infrastructure activity.
Others
The Others category includes niche or blended aggregates tailored for specialized uses, from lightweight mixes to decorative applications. Demand arises in projects with unique performance or aesthetic criteria and in regions promoting alternative materials to reduce the carbon footprint of construction. Suppliers leverage R&D, certifications, and pilot collaborations with contractors to validate performance and secure specification listings.

Substitutes: The global aggregates market, a cornerstone of construction and infrastructure development, is experiencing shifts driven by various factors, including environmental concerns, technological advancements, and evolving construction practices. Aggregates, comprising crushed stone, gravel, sand, and other materials, serve as the fundamental building blocks for roads, bridges, buildings, and other structures. However, increasing environmental regulations and community opposition to quarrying have prompted the exploration of substitutes and alternative materials.
One substitute gaining traction is recycled aggregates, derived from crushed concrete, asphalt, and other demolished materials. Recycling these materials not only reduces the demand for virgin aggregates but also alleviates waste disposal issues. Additionally, recycled aggregates often exhibit comparable performance to natural aggregates, making them an attractive option for sustainable construction projects. Furthermore, advancements in processing technologies have enhanced the quality and consistency of recycled aggregates, further bolstering their appeal in the market.
Another emerging substitute is the use of alternative materials such as industrial by-products and agricultural waste. Materials like slag from steel production, fly ash from coal combustion, and bottom ash from waste incineration can be processed and utilized as aggregates in construction applications. Similarly, agricultural by-products like rice husk ash and sugarcane bagasse ash are being investigated for their potential as supplementary aggregates. Embracing these alternatives not only reduces reliance on traditional aggregates but also promotes circular economy principles by repurposing waste materials. However, challenges remain in terms of quality control, availability, and cost-effectiveness, hindering widespread adoption.
